What is Hosts File ?

The hosts file is a text file containing domain names and IP address associated with them.
Location of hosts file in windows: C:\Windows\System32\drivers\etc\, Whenever we visit any website, say www.anything.com , an query is sent to Domain Name Server(DNS) to look up for the IP address associated with that website/domain. But before doing this the hosts file on our local computer is checked for the IP address associated to the domain name.

Suppose we make an entry in hosts file as shown. When we visit www.anywebsite.com , we would be taken to this 115.125.124.50. No query for resolving IP address associated with www.anywebsite.com would be sent to DNS.

Countermeasures:-
 
Never just blindly enter your credentials in a login page even if you yourself have typed a domain name in
web browser. Check the protocol whether it is "http" or "https" . https is secure,
